Discover more about Collis P. Huntington Statue

The Collis P. Huntington Statue stands proudly in Huntington, West Virginia, as a testament to the city's historical significance in the development of America's transportation network. Erected to honor Collis Potter Huntington, a prominent railroad magnate and philanthropist, this statue captures the essence of the man who played a pivotal role in shaping the region's economic landscape during the 19th century. Visitors to this site can reflect on Huntington's legacy while enjoying the serene surroundings that the statue offers. The statue is not only a piece of art but a historical marker that tells the story of industrial progress and ambition.
